DescriptionThis intensive one-year certificate leads to careers in the visual arts — a great stepping stone for employment in such areas as professional art making, gallery/museum work, graphic design, industrial design, fashion design, and art education. Taught by professional artists and educators, this program fosters individual development in creative thinking, problem solving, technical skills, and management for the business side of your career — copyright, contracts, commissions, and more.
